Ingredients
- Crust Ingredients
- 1-1/2 cups coarsely crushed pretzels
- 1/2 cup sugar
- 1/3 cup butter, melted
- 2 tablespoons bottled nonalcoholic margarita mix
- Cake Ingredients
- 1 box white cake mix
- 1-1/4 cups bottled nonalcoholic margarita mix
- 2 tablespoons tequila (optional)
- 1/3 cup oil
- 1 tablespoon grated lime peel (about 1 lime)
- 3 egg whites
- 1 container (8 oz) frozen whipped topping, thawed
- Additional lime slices and/or green decorating sugars, if desired

Preparation
Step 1
Heat oven to 350°F. Grease bottom only of 13×9-inch pan with shortening and lightly.
In a medium bowl, mix pretzels, sugar, butter, and margarita mix. Spread evenly and press gently into bottom of pan. Set aside.
In a large bowl, beat cake mix, margarita mix, tequila (if using), oil, 1 tablespoon lime peel and the egg whites with electric mixer for about 2 minutes, scraping bowl occasionally. Pour batter over pretzel mixture.
Bake cake for 33 to 35 minutes or until light golden brown. Cool completely, about 2 hours. Frost with whipped topping; decorate with additional lime slices and or green sugars. Store covered in refrigerator.
